The Stanley Cup pays a visit to the Grasshopper in Morristown

These days, Morristown hockey fans will take the Stanley Cup any way they can get it–even if it comes by way of Chicago.

The Stanley Cup parked upstairs yesterday at Morristown's Grasshopper Off the Green, where former Devils favorite John Madden had a private party. John helped the Chicago Blackhawks win hockey's greatest prize in June.

The fabled trophy came to town yesterday courtesy of former New Jersey Devil John Madden, who in June helped the Chicago Blackhawks win their first National Hockey League championship in 49 years.

John showed off the 34 1/2-pound Cup at a private party at Grasshopper Off the Green during the afternoon.

Earlier, his Cup caravan stopped at the Twin Oaks rink off Columbia Turnpike, and at St. Barnabas Hospital in Livingston.

Next stop: Goryeb Children’s Hospital at Morristown Memorial Hospital on Saturday at 11 a.m.

The former University of Michigan star also won the Cup twice with the Devils, where he skated for a decade. John still makes his summer home in the Garden State.

The Stanley Cup dates to 1893. Since 1995, members of Stanley Cup-winning teams have been given some personal time with the trophy during the off-season.

John, who is known for his defensive skills and penalty killing, won’t get a chance to repeat with the Blackhawks this season.

Facing salary cap constraints, Chicago has unloaded at least nine members of its championship team, including John.

The 37-year-old center has signed a one-year deal with the Minnesota Wild.
